What is a central idea?
A central idea can be defined as the main point of a literary work, which is used by a writer to join together all of the other elements of fiction when writing a true story.
This ultimately implies that, the statements which describe the central idea of a text include:
- It's the most important ideas in a text.
- It's supported by details.
- It can be explicitly stated or implied.
